Another one from Chinatown, San Francisco, taken on 29th of November 2007.

By the way, these Buddhist nuns who appear so solemn here in the street, laughed and joked together as they looked at the merchandise in the shop where we next saw them. A really unexpected difference!

In case anyone asks about the use of 1600 ISO, I must have had it set for an interior shot. I certainly do recall that when I turned and saw these nuns approaching, I had to react immediately to get the picture. (A little luminance noise reduction used in Adobe RAW, and then more selective noise reduction done on the TIFF in Photoshop.)
